Trivia about the song Falling Out by The Hal Al Shedad

When was the song “Falling Out” released by The Hal Al Shedad?
The song Falling Out was released in 1996, on the album “The Hal Al Shedad”.
Who composed the song “Falling Out” by The Hal Al Shedad?
The song “Falling Out” by The Hal Al Shedad was composed by Benjamin Lukens, Ed Rawls, James Joyce.
